Definitions

bouffantnoun
A hairstyle characterized by hair that is raised high and rounded, often with the use of teasing or padding.
She wore her hair in a bouffant for the wedding, giving her a classic and elegant look.
bouffantadjective
Having a puffed-out or voluminous shape, often used to describe hairstyles or clothing.
She wore a bouffant dress that made her look like she stepped out of a 1950s fashion magazine.
